The Ula & Violet Podcast is a place for real conversations about real life and real faith. Hosted by Amanda, this podcast is for anyone who has ever felt like following God was too complicated or too intimidating. Here you will find honest reflections, encouragement, scripture, and prayers shared from the perspective of someone learning to walk with Jesus one imperfect step at a time. No perfection, no pretending, just simple everyday faith.

What’s Sitting in Your Heart Right Now?

Some days aren’t polished. Some days are led. In this episode, Amanda sits down on a Sunday morning after feeling a pull to open her Bible and listen closely. What unfolds is an honest, unfiltered reflection on Acts 2 and Revelation 3 — specifically the weight of unforgiveness and the reality of living as a lukewarm Christian. This isn’t a perfectly structured message. It’s a real one. Through personal reflection, Amanda talks about: – How easy it is to carry resentment and how heavy it actually becomes – Why forgiveness isn’t about the other person — it’s about freeing your own heart – What it truly means to be “lukewarm” and how subtle that place can be – Letting go of self-reliance and returning to God fully, not conditionally – Recognizing Jesus is always knocking — but He won’t force His way in This episode is for anyone who feels tired, overwhelmed, stuck in their thoughts, or unsure where they stand in their faith. You don’t have to have it all figured out. You just have to be willing to open the door.

You Are Allowed to Take Up Space

Stepping out of our comfort zone can feel uncomfortable, especially when we’re used to staying quiet and flying under the radar. In this episode, Amanda shares what it has been like to start the Ula & Violet podcast and the internal battle that often comes with following a calling placed on your heart. From self-doubt to procrastination to wondering whether anyone is even listening, these thoughts are more common than we realize. But sometimes the quiet fire inside keeps reminding us to keep going anyway. This conversation reflects on the idea that we are allowed to take up space in the world. If God has placed something on your heart that refuses to be quiet, it may be there for a reason. Even planting one small seed can make a difference in someone’s life. Whether you are new to faith, returning to it, or simply trying to understand what God might be asking of you, this episode is an encouragement to trust that nudge, step forward, and allow God to guide the path.

Designed on Purpose, Not by Accident

There has never been, and will never be, another person who can live this exact life from your exact perspective. In this episode, I talk about the reality that God designed you intentionally. Your personality, your experiences, your gifts, and your voice are not accidental. Comparing yourself to someone else is exhausting and unnecessary. No one else can bring what you bring to the table. I share how Ula & Violet began as an Etsy shop focused on selling products but slowly transformed into something more meaningful. The focus shifted from income to impact. From selling to serving. From building a store to using my voice. Creating free Bible study guides and offering tools became more important than numbers. I also talk about what I see in my work, those moments when someone physically exhales in my office. That soul breath when they finally feel safe enough to release what they have been carrying. Those moments remind me that each of us was designed to offer something specific to the world. You only get this one opportunity to live life as you. The question is not whether you measure up to someone else. The question is whether you are stewarding what God already placed in your hands.

Look Up

It is easy to feel like we have to stay plugged into everything happening around us. The headlines, the arguments, the constant urgency. At first it can feel responsible, like paying attention means we care. But over time, that constant intake can leave us tense, reactive, and worn down rather than wise. In this episode, we talk about the quiet reminder to look up. Not as an escape from reality, but as a realignment. There is a difference between being aware of the world and letting it shape the condition of the heart. When everything we consume begins to form us, we can lose sight of what is meant to anchor us. Drawing from Paul’s letter to the Colossians, this conversation explores how to stay grounded in Christ while still living in a complicated world. How to care without being consumed, respond without reacting, and live from a place of patience, mercy, and love instead of outrage and exhaustion. This is not about ignoring what is happening around us. It is about choosing what forms us first.
